Specificity
|
RM120 reacts to the heavy chain of human IgG4, RM120 does not cross react to any other IgG subclasses (IgG1, IgG2, or IgG3), and shows no cross reactivity to IgM, IgA, IgD, IgE. RM120 does not react to monkey (Cyno or Rhesus) IgG, mouse IgG, rat IgG, or goat IgG.
|
Immunogen
|
Peptide corresponding to the hinge region of Human IgG4

Western Blot of human, mouse, rat, and goat
IgG shows RM120 reacts to human IgG4, in
both whole molecule (~150kDa, non-reduced)
and heavy chain (~50kDa, reduced) forms. No
cross reactivity with other isotypes of human IgG,
or mouse, rat, or goat IgG.
